I have two HD-PVRs plugged into the USB ports on my mobo (which is an Asus P5Q-Pro). These are both connected to Rogers HD cable boxes (SA3250HDs) and channel changing is done via firewire. I also have an SD cable box connected to a PCI based tuner for which I use a USB-UIRT to change channels.
